Police pursue large box truck on freeway over felony warrantMonrovia CA

audio iconTraffic
I-210, Monrovia, CA

Police officers pursued a large box truck westbound on the 210 freeway near Monrovia. The truck driver was wanted on a felony warrant related to firearms and explosives. The pursuit involved several sheriff's units and proceeded through multiple freeway interchanges including Irwindale, 605, Buena Vista, and Central exits. The truck moved at speeds around 50 to 65 miles per hour, mostly in light traffic. It was unknown if the suspect was armed.
